A Genome-Scale Metabolic Model of , S2 for CO, Capture and Conversion to Methane,Methane is a major energy source for heating and electricity. Its production by methanogenic bacteria is widely known in nature. . S2 is a fully sequenced hydrogenotrophic methanogen and an excellent laboratory strain with robust genetic tools. However, a quantitative systems biology model to complement these tools is absent in the literature.作者: Perceive 時間: 2025-3-24 16:44
